Hi all — welcome to the team, and a quick summary of last night's cut-over. We moved nightly backfills from the legacy cron host to Lanternjob, our new scheduler. All 41 jobs migrated cleanly; two needed retry-policy tweaks, which Priya handled before the 02:00 window. The old host stays read-only for two weeks as a fallback, then gets decommissioned. Please review job ownership in the Lanternjob console this week. For reference during the transition, the scheduler now runs with the following configuration.

service settings:
PRAIX_LOG_LEVEL=error
PRAIX_METRICS_HOST=metrics.praix.qorvelcorp.corp
PRAIX_POOL_SIZE=16

Runbook: Inkpress template rendering. p95 regressed from 80ms to 410ms after partial caching was disabled in last week's deploy. Mitigation: re-enable the cache flag, restart renderer pods, confirm p95 under 100ms on the dashboard. Root cause fix lands next sprint. The mitigated build is identified by the token below.

pipeline stamp: htk9_a0b51dc51

Finance Review — Tollgate Logistics, Expansion Update

Board, quick summary: the push into the Marivel corridor is going better than the model predicted. Freight volumes are up 12% against plan, and the Ostbruck depot hit breakeven two months early. Yes, fuel costs bit us in month one, but renegotiated carrier rates mostly closed the gap. We want approval to accelerate phase two by a quarter. Full numbers in the appendix. The confidential strategy note sits just below.

board note of bagug-kafof: The steering committee signed off on a budget of $55.0 million for Project Fraox. The renewal with Fenvanek Freight closes at $37.0 million a year, 4 percent above the last contract.

Subject: ORM cut-over done

For the sync: the Pellwick orders service is now fully off the legacy Ironvine ORM. Adapter layer is live, shadow writes disabled, old tables read-only. Latency flat, error rate unchanged over 48 hours. Remaining cleanup tracked for next sprint. Anyone running the service locally should update their environment to the values below.

config for yajep-tafof:
[rusath]
team = julmir
access_code = ac_fe37fd
host = rusath.novactech.test
port = 8000
owner = pelmir.weneth
peer = oliwyn.olvarqdyn.internal